Most people, when planning a vacation, will check into a hotel or guest house. However, for those who like to move around, motorhomes and travel trailers Ontario is the preferred option. These two options both have pros and cons but are a great way to spend your holiday and do a bit of exploring.

When choosing a motorhome there a many things to think about. Fully equipped and at the high end very luxurious they are not the cheapest of vehicles. As little as 20, 000 dollars can be spent but bear in mind that this is an entry level small unit. If you want a large fully equipped motorhome with all the gadgets you will be looking to spend in excess of 150, 000 dollars and in some cases much more. Some buyers choose to design their own and this will also increase the cost.

Travel trailers are the other alternative. These trailers also come in a range of sizes to suit every ones needs. Again ranging from 2 berth to 10 berth and also in most cases very well furnished. Obviously the major difference is that you will need a towing vehicle to pull your unit. It is very important when choosing your trailer that your towing vehicle is powerful enough for your needs, and dealers in Hamilton, ON will be happy to advise you on this matter and many will have a list of recommended cars and trucks to meet your needs.

Both of these types of units can also be hired for periods of time. From as little as 1500 dollars per week for a motorhome or a little less for a trailer. This is a great way to asses these units if you are thinking of investing in one.

One of the major things to consider is fuel consumption. Due to the size and weight of these units they use a fair amount of gas and you should budget for this when planning your trip. A trailer will typically return somewhere around 8 to 12 miles on a single gallon where as a motorhome will be less at approximately 5 to 8 mpg. Insurance costs are also something to look into and it is worth shopping around due to the specialist nature of these units.

When deciding on a site there are many options where you can park up for your stay. Many sites will charge between 10 and 20 dollars per night for a pitch, electricity, water and sewage services will be extra and this will vary depending on the site. The more luxurious campsites equipped with swimming pools, restaurants and bars can exceed 50 dollars per night so also factor this into your holiday budget.

Whichever option you choose there are many things to think about. With a motorhome if you have a breakdown and the vehicle needs to go into the repair shop you have also lost your accommodation. With a trailer if you break down you still have somewhere to stay whilst your repairs are carried out and if a serious problem there is always the option of renting another towing vehicle.
